    One thing to remember if you have a Julie the Pinball- there's an extra step for that machine as one of the circuit boards hangs down in the way of the large green plastic frame. Facing the back of the machine, there's a plastic lever on the left side of it that will release it.

    Simple step, but I can see someone going 'how the hell did that get there?'

    The LCD is pushed so far back into the playfield to accommodate the pinball playfield that there wasn't room to mount the motherboard normally...

    I'm not really sure. I asked him what Lumina cells he had. He listed Indy, Star Wars, Marilyn Monroe and a fourth one which I think was for the Victory frame. I just asked if he had a Shimura World cell. He checked and said he did. Later on, I read someone's post here that he had a Julie cell. I asked him about that and he said he sold it already. So it sounds like either he isn't sure what cells he has or he's willing to pull out cells from beat up frames/doors. Either way it's a good thing. You pay about half the shipping cost and the cells are around $100 off what he charges for the full machine. Plus I don't have to try to find room for another one.
